Gerhard Howe has been practising as an independent lawyer in Berlin since 1995, specialising in migration law. His areas of expertise cover obtaining both temporary and indefinite residence permits, as well as visas. He also assists with family reunification, spousal and child sponsorship, skilled worker immigration, student visas, protection against expulsion and deportation, and naturalisation.

Since 2019, Mr Howe has been involved with GerVie GmbH, which trains, places and represents young skilled workers from Vietnam.
